Latest Patents
Among his latest patents is a process for manufacturing a rope, which significantly reduces the modulus of stretch by impregnating spaced-apart segments of the rope with an epoxy plastic. This innovative method allows the modulus of stretch of the segments to equal zero after curing the plastic, enhancing the overall performance of the rope. Another significant patent involves a means and method for dynamically monitoring the stretch of a seismic isolator. This invention utilizes a variable-gap, distributed-capacitance sensor that provides an output signal based on its instantaneous elongation, allowing for precise measurement of the seismic isolator's stretch.
